Software Developer

Barnett Waddingham ,
Cheltenham, Gloucestershire

Overview

BW are an independent UK consultancy at the forefront of risk, pensions, investment and insurance with over 1,300 employees spread across 8 offices. We invest heavily in cutting-edge technology: IT is a key part of our success and our clients include many large household name companies. The role You will cover all aspects of software development such as analysis, coding, testing, deployment, support and documentation, and will be involved in a mixture of developing of new features and maintaining existing functionality. You will be expected to continuously improve your knowledge of software technology and tools. Our solutions are built primarily on the Microsoft stack: · Languages: C#; TypeScript · Frameworks: .Net Framework and .NET Core; ASP.NET; Entity Framework; Angular · Principles: Automated testing, build and deployment; cloud and on-prem; SOLID You will need to be familiar with the existing code base, develop an understanding of the business context in which the software is used and identify limitations and areas for improvement. You will also be required to plan, attend and contribute to team meetings and mentor junior team members. The person As a minimum, you will have 5 years’ experience of commercial software development along with GCSE Grade C (4/5) or equivalent in Maths and English. A degree in a technical subject (Maths, Physics, Engineering, Computer Science or similar) is highly desirable. A willingness to gain the PMI Award in Pension Essentials qualification would be beneficial. What we offer 25 days holiday with the option to buy more, a generous pension scheme and a discretionary but competitive annual bonus A wide range of flexible rewards & benefits designed to suit your age and lifestyle Career progression opportunities and a focus on training and professional development Free fresh fruit and hot & cold drinks Sports & social clubs and groups 1 paid volunteering day per year Dress-down Fridays Modern, comfortable offices This job was originally posted as www.cwjobs.co.uk/job/89840327